YAY!! Pico-kitty is going to be alright!
Poor Pico was born with (or received shortly after birth) a number of holes in the muscles along his right side (hernias) which caused him all sorts of grief and pain. Originally the vet we took him to (who I did not like or trust) told us it was a basal cell cystic tumour and to watch it for a while. What would happen was that the lump on that grew and shrank on his side was actually his intestine poking through one of those holes and his feces getting trapped along the intruding part.
When we got back from getting married we found out that he'd been quite sick and it was obvious (to me) that he'd lost a bunch of weight although he had been eating fairly regularly. I decided that enough was enough and took him into the Guildford Animal Hospital where the very nice Dr. Grewal did some tests and determined that it wasn't feline leukemia, feline AIDS, or liver disease, and that everything was related to these hernias. Pico went into surgery yesterday and came out fine. We went and saw him today to bring him some of his favourite food (frozen shrimp - kitty popsicles) and visit with him for a bit. He ate like he was starving and I left a bunch of them with the staff there. He's got a 4-5 inch scar down his abdomen and a 2-3 inch scar on his side and is currently hooked up to an IV to rehydrate and medicate him. He's going to be fine, which makes me very happy. He's the sweetest little cat I've ever had the pleasure of dealing with. I look forward to him getting all better and coming home.
